Hi Bantam1;

Recently received a new 2020 Twin Power 2500 and it is really smooth, noticeably more than my sustain. That's the good news. I also ordered a 2020 Metanium 151B (yea, I'm switching to a lefty :) ) and because of the Corona Virus it has been backordered and the ETA has changed from May 05 > May 21 > July 05.

I'll bet I'm not the first to think about this, so I'll ask realizing the answer might be a little biased coming from a Shimano employee, and may not even be answerable in a forum but I'll ask anyway. What concerns me about the virus delays is how it will affect the quality of the reels being made during this time? It can't be easy to maintain quality when the assembler is wearing a mask and possibly gloves, working longer hours to make up for the sick, etc. I would hate to cancel my order and wait until maybe the end of year when things have hopefully settled down a bit, but getting a lemon of a fairly expensive reel is a concern too.

Do you know if there has been enhanced manufacturing methods employed by Shimano like slower assembly times, more detailed final inspections, etc. to ensure the quality of the reels during these difficult times?

Thanks for any information you can give. PM me if needed.

You have to remember these workers are in a factory where there is machining taking place, paint, ect. They are always wearing protective gear. There will be delays due to closures and other issues related to the CV. Aside from that there have been no changes in the factories.

They are coming in next month. The reels have been trickling in and more coming around summer. This is pretty standard for new products. There is always a slight delay in the amount of reels based on production capacity of the factory. The Metanium is also a global product, so everyone gets a share until they can work on filling the pipeline.
